Understanding the Mechanics and Probability
At its heart, a crash game is a form of a provably fair game. This means the outcome of each round is determined by a cryptographic algorithm that allows players to verify the randomness and fairness of the results. This transparency is crucial for building trust and attracting players who are wary of rigged systems. The multiplier in a crash game isn’t predetermined; it’s generated by this algorithm, usually involving a seed value provided by the server and another contributed by the player. The combination of these seeds ensures that neither the player nor the operator can manipulate the outcome. Understanding this foundational principle is key to approaching the game responsibly and with a clear understanding of the odds.
The probability of the crash happening at any given moment isn’t uniform. While it’s statistically random, the algorithm is designed to generally increase the multiplier over time, but with a decreasing probability of continuing. This means that the longer the multiplier climbs, the higher the risk of a crash becomes. This creates a constantly shifting risk-reward dynamic that demands constant attention and quick decision-making. Players need to weigh the potential for a larger payout against the increasing likelihood of losing their stake. Some strategies involve setting predetermined cash-out points, aiming for a specific multiple, while others rely on observing the game’s history – though past results do not guarantee future outcomes due to the nature of randomness.

Managing Risk and Bankroll Effectively
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ial skill in crash gaming. Without a sound strategy for managing your funds, you’re likely to quickly deplete your capital, regardless of your betting strategy. A common rule of thumb is to never risk more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single bet. This helps to mitigate losses and prolong your playing time, increasing your chances of eventually profiting. Diversifying your betting approach can also be beneficial, such as alternating between conservative and more aggressive strategies. Consider also using the stop-loss and take-profit orders where available on various platforms.
Another important aspect of risk management is understanding the concept of variance. Variance refers to the degree to which actual results deviate from expected results. Crash games are inherently volatile, meaning that you can experience significant swings in your bankroll, even when employing a sound strategy. It’s important to be prepared for these fluctuations and avoid making impulsive decisions based on short-term outcomes. Long-term profitability is the goal, and requires patience and discipline. Don't fall into the trap of thinking that a losing streak means your strategy is flawed, or a winning streak guarantees continued success.

The Psychological Aspects of Crash Gaming
Crash games are not just about mathematical probabilities and strategic betting; they also involve a significant psychological component. The fast-paced nature of the game, combined with the potential for quick wins and losses, can trigger strong emotional responses. Greed and fear are two emotions that can easily cloud judgment and lead to impulsive decisions. The temptation to push for a higher multiplier, even when you’ve already achieved a reasonable profit, can be overwhelming, but often results in losing everything. Similarly, the fear of losing can lead to prematurely cashing out, leaving potential profits on the table. Maintaining a calm and rational mindset is critical for success.
Understanding your own psychological tendencies is essential. Are you prone to impulsive behavior? Do you tend to chase losses? Identifying your weaknesses can help you develop strategies to mitigate their impact. Taking regular breaks, avoiding playing when stressed or emotional, and practicing mindfulness techniques can all contribute to a more balanced and rational approach. It’s also important to remember that crash games are designed to be entertaining, and you shouldn’t allow them to negatively impact your overall well-being.
